Chris Nelson’s Kembla Grange Best Bets Posted on August 13, 2021August 13, 2021 | Posted by Chris Nelson RACE 3 No.7 Criminal Code Kathy O’Hara links up with champion trainer Chris Waller on this middle distance galloper who steps up to 2000m for the first time this campaign. His only start over the trip was at the end of his last prep when just over 2 lengths behind Harpo Marx who is currently in top form. Happy to pot the favourite Ziegfeld who is rising sharply to a trip he’s yet to race over, in fact 1600m is as far as he’s been! RACE 8 No.1 Tiger Of Malay Winner of the Group 2 Sires at Eagle Farm two starts back before a gallant third in the Group 1 Atkins same track a fortnight later after a tardy beginning. Liked his recent trial in a heat restricted for Group and Listed winners finishing off nicely under no urgings. Plenty of weight however he’s earned it and just looks to have a bit on these. RACE 10 No.2 Rule The World Wasn’t the best to leave the gates first up and as a result settled last. Still back there at the tail until well into the straight he picked up steadily over the final 200m making good ground to the line. Overall he recorded the quickest final 400m of the race and the equal fastest final split of the entire day. Bowman sticks, better gate, goes close!
